Considering your UK Trip? ETA vs. Visa Guide

When travelling to the United Kingdom, you'll need to confirm your entry specifications. While most visitors can simply apply for an Electronic Travel Authorisation (ETA), particular nationalities might require a traditional visa. An ETA is a straightforward electronic form that grants you permission more info to enter the UK for tourism. However, a visa involves a more detailed application process and may be needed for longer stays or certain purposes, like study or work.

Note that, always apply well in advance of your planned travel dates.
